[22a-W241-8] Electric-Field-Induced X-ray Magnetic Circular Dichroism for Studying Perpendicularly Magnetized Ni/Cu Multilayers

岡林 潤1、谷山 智康2 (1.東大理、2.東工大)

キーワード:X-ray Magnetic Circular Dichroism,Electric field control,Perpendicularly magnetic anisotropy

Electric-field control of magnetic anisotropy is an important subject in spintronics research. Applying an electric field to BaTiO3 makes it possible to tune the lattice volume by modulating the domain structures along the a- and c-axis directions. Electric-field control of the magnetic properties of Ni/Cu multilayers on BaTiO3 was achieved, in which the magnetization switches from perpendicular to the in-plane magnetic easy axes. We have developed a novel technique of X-ray magnetic circular dichroism (XMCD) under an applied electric field in NiCu/BaTiO3 to clarify the mechanism of the electric-field-induced changes in the magnetic anisotropy.
